Output 331295cb89858d397f2f43a85f33c2d8f5a16b64d73b8b95242416273728298f:0

value
21733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e380ac45dc3cd37336fac0ec690247668f5e6023 OP_EQUAL
address
3NRwTSavC1LvNUvwqJ1o9s2hcVLkBZbWgM
transaction
331295cb89858d397f2f43a85f33c2d8f5a16b64d73b8b95242416273728298f
confirmations
179353
spent
true